CVE-2026-24173

Published April 7, 2026 · Updated April 8, 2026

7.5CVSS
high

What This Means

CVE-2026-24173 is a high-severity vulnerability in NVIDIA Triton Inference Server, where an attacker can send a malformed request that causes the server to crash. This results in a denial of service, disrupting the availability of the inference services. To mitigate this risk, organizations using Triton Inference Server should implement input validation and monitor server logs for suspicious request patterns.

Official Description+

NVIDIA Triton Inference Server contains a vulnerability where an attacker could cause a server crash by sending a malformed request to the server. A successful exploit of this vulnerability might lead to denial of service.
